With exposed beams and vaulted ceilings, Ty Tatws is a character cottage centrally placed for easy access to the St Davids peninsula, numerous beautiful beaches and the Pembrokeshire Coastal Path. This is an ideal location for exploring the many delights this area has to offer: bird watching, walking, surfing, enjoying the stunning beaches, fishing or simply taking time out to watch the world go by.

One of a small group of cottages, Ty Tatws is surrounded by rolling countryside on the fringe of the Pembrokeshire Coast National Park, a short drive from Fishguard and the charming village of Goodwick. The cathedral city of St Davids, the sheltered fishing cove of Abercastle and the charming harbour at Solva are just a few miles away along with the safe, clean, sandy beaches of Whitesands and Newgale. There are excellent restaurants, cafes and pubs throughout the area; alternatively excellent fresh produce can be obtained direct from local suppliers.

Ty Tatws (Welsh for ‘Potato House’) was converted from an 18th century barn to provide an extremely comfortable two bedroom holiday cottage and it maintains a unique character with old slate and stone features throughout. The cottage boasts a host of modern facilities and provides a quiet, warm, country-style dwelling with a southerly aspect garden at the front.

Accommodation
Ty Tatws sleeps 4 in 2 ground floor bedrooms, a double bedroom with two built in wardrobes, a dressing table and a hand basin and a large twin bedroom which has room for a cot if you would like to bring one with you. Also on the ground floor is the modern bathroom which has a bath with shower over, WC, basin, heated towel rail, electric heater and shaver point.

Upstairs is a large open plan room consisting of a living area with two sofas, chairs, a flatscreen TV and a DVD player. The dining area has a table with seating for 6. The kitchen has hand built pine units with electric cooker, washing machine, tumble dryer, fridge and microwave. The room is heated with an electric wood burner type stove.

Outside
The southerly facing garden has high stone walls to provide a very sheltered area with a picnic table and seating for 6 for alfresco dining or simply soaking up the peace and tranquillity. The hard surface area immediately to the front of the cottage leads to a neatly kept lawn surrounded by shrubs. This outside area also includes a rotary washing line and private off road parking for two cars.
